Diploma in Nurse Prescribing
This Diploma in Nurse Prescribing is designed for those who work in nursing and want to learn more about Nursing & Prescribing procedures or how to work with a prescriber. This Diploma in Nurse Prescribing is also appropriate for pharmacists and other healthcare professionals interested in learning about independent prescribing.
With this Diploma in Nurse Prescribing, you will learn how to write prescriptions, keep records, label drugs, administer controlled substances, and provide palliative care and manage medicines in nursing homes.
